What if decluttering your home is the first step toward real, lasting peace?

In this episode, Jess sits down with Liz LaVoie to talk about the powerful connection between our homes and our hearts, and how decluttering both can lead us to true, lasting peace.

This isn’t about becoming a minimalist. It’s about becoming content.
